STANPAC is a dynamic Canadian based company that has been manufacturing dairy and beverage packaging for more than 60 years. Since 1949 we have been actively committed to expanding our product lines with new products and innovations for the ice cream, fluid milk, wine, and spirit markets. With additional facilities in Texas and New Jersey, Stanpac continues the evolution of our great company by introducing new products, sizes, and configurations for an ever-changing market.
